About the artist:
Lacalle is a Spanish artist with a solid career and a coherent artistic evolution, developed over more than a decade of training at the studio of painter and gallerist Nieves Solana (Madrid).
Her work sits on a transitional line between contemporary expressionism and geometric abstraction, with a clearly defined plastic identity where color acts as the structural axis of the composition.
She works on multiple supports (canvas, panel, paper) and techniques (oil, acrylic, mixed media), with particular attention to textures, glazes, and color construction, bringing depth and visual richness to each work.
She has exhibited individually and collectively in various spaces in Spain and Portugal.
